Barry Morphew jailed in Colorado following alleged Denver hit-and-run crash

Prosecutors state Morphew violated his bond conditions during a trip to Denver International Airport.

The short version

  • Barry Morphew was arrested and booked into the Boulder County Jail after prosecutors stated he was involved in a three-vehicle hit-and-run crash in Denver.[Associated Press · ABC News]
  • Prosecutors filed court documents alleging the August 28 airport trip breached Morphew's travel restrictions under his $3 million bond.[Associated Press · ABC News]
  • Morphew, who faces trial next summer for first-degree murder in his wife Suzanne's 2020 death, is scheduled for a bond hearing before Judge Amanda Hopkins.[Associated Press]
